PowerShell CSVファイルを読み込んで、特定の列だけCSVファイルに出力するPowerShellのサンプルコード
CSVファイルを読み込んで、特定の列だけCSVファイルに出力するPowerShellのサンプルコードします。(不要な列は除去)実行イメージまずはCSVファイルを読み込みます。列名が「ID」、「名前」、「年齢」、「プログラミング経験」の4列定義されています。ここから、「ID」、「名前」の列だけ取得してCSV出力します。(「年齢」、「プログラミング経験」の列は不要なので、破棄)フォルダ構成は以下のような感じです。入力ファイル(CSVファイル)出力ファイル(列絞り込みした結果のCSVファイル) ※最初はファイルがなくてもよいです。作成されます。powershellの実行ファイルソースコード以下のコマンド、ps1ファイル、入力ファイル(サンプル)を準備しておきます。コマンドpowershell -ExecutionPolicy RemoteSigned -File "selectCsvFile.ps1"サンプルコード:whereCsvFile.ps1# CSVファイル入力$getContent = Import-Csv .\01.input.csv -Encoding UTF8# 列絞り込み$...